The law requires employers to act reasonably in their discipline of employees and in dealing with grievances. Poorly handled processes can lead to unnecessary and costly employment tribunals. This practical full day event will provide you with detailed knowledge, skills and techniques to effectively manage and conduct employee discipline and grievance procedures within your workplace.

Business Need

Having effective and compliant procedures in place can encourage people to observe the rules and maintain workplace standards. If staff problems are settled early they become less time-consuming, are less likely to damage working relationships, therefore improving staff motivation and productivity.

With case studies and practical exercises, this full day event will provide delegates with techniques for handling disciplinary and grievance meetings, as well as an in-depth understanding of the legal background which underpins the tribunal process, including the industry recognised Acas Code of Practice on Discipline and Grievance.

Delegates will have the opportunity throughout the day to learn through discussion of experiences to add a real life context to the discipline and grievance principles.

Programme

Our expert-led training sessions are designed to facilitate discussion and interaction. This full day event is interactive to embed learning and will cover in detail:

  • The Acas Code on disciplinary and grievance procedures; how to use it
  • Resolving issues informally and when formal action is necessary
  • Setting of clear rules and how to communicate them 
  • When suspension is an option and how it should be handled
  • Relevant case law
  • The importance of record keeping
  • Holding a disciplinary or grievance meeting – and how to conduct it
  • Deciding when an internal investigation is necessary and what it should consist of
  • Taking appropriate action and the proper use of penalties and sanctions
  • Dealing with appeals
